Some BMWs come with a second key, also called the Digital Key (or Display Key) in addition to the standard key. The Digital Key app on your iPhone replaces your key fob. You need an iPhone compatible with the app and a valid Apple ID to activate it. After registering an account, you'll need to follow the instructions on the Apple Wallet application to pair your device with your vehicle. You can then transfer the Digital Key to another compatible device, or remove it from your smartphone and place it in your vehicle's Smart Key Tray.

Key Fobs

Key fobs can be used to lock or unlock vehicles, open trunks and arm alarms. Over the years they have become more sophisticated. They now have security features, such as rolling code technology, which prevents hackers from stealing signals. Certain fobs can also be connected to smartphones and other devices, allowing them to perform a greater range of functions. Fobs can be extremely convenient and can be particularly useful for those with disabilities who are unable to turn physical keys.

Numerous car manufacturers offer various key fobs. The design and functions depend on the model and brand. Some of the more sophisticated ones come with a touchscreen. A few even allow the driver to park the car remotely by tapping on the fob's touchscreen when the car is in reverse or in a tight parking spot.

The fobs themselves may differ in size and shape. Some are elegant, while others can be large. For example, BMW's i8 Key fob is an elongated device with tiny touchscreens that are built into the top. The 2.2-inch display provides information about the status of the car, including the level of fuel and whether or not the windows are shut.

Fobs may also have a variety of buttons, such as one that allows the owner to lower all windows at once. Some cars even have a button that allows the owner to turn on the engine remotely on cold winter days, but Consumer Reports recommends using this option only if it is legal in your state.

Battery Replacement

bmw replacement key fob automobiles are usually fitted with smart keys that can be used to lock and unlock the car, or even start it with a simple press of a key. However, these sophisticated key fobs are powered by an internal battery that can be worn out by regular use. It's easy to replace the battery on a majority of BMW key fobs. To begin, you'll need a screwdriver and a new BMW key battery. You can purchase both of these items in most hardware stores or office supply stores.

If your BMW keyfob has a side indent, it is likely to have a rechargeable lithium-ion battery which recharges when you insert the key into the ignition. To change the battery, you'll need remove the valet key and use an screwdriver to open the access port at the bottom of the key fob. Once you've removed the cover you can replace the old battery with a new one and close the key fob's two halves together.

You can test the new BMW key batteries by pressing the unlock key on the key fob. You'll know it's working properly when you hear a snapping sound that indicates that the key fob has been closed correctly. The valet key can be inserted back into the ignition to begin your vehicle as normal.

If your BMW key fob is equipped with a standard battery that does not charge, it's probably easier to replace the battery on your own. You'll require a screwdriver as well as the replacement battery, which is available at most hardware stores and office supply stores. Be careful not to scratch the circuit board or battery contacts by opening the key fob's casing. If you're uncomfortable changing the battery yourself, a qualified BMW technician can handle it for you in a short session.
